    New Findings from University Juarez Autonoma of Tabasco in the Area of Support V ector Machines Described (Asymptotic Behavior of Some Multicategory Classificati on Methods for High-dimensional Data)

    61-61页
    查看更多>>摘要:By a News Reporter-Staff News Editor at Robotics & Machine Learning Daily News Daily News-New research on Machine Learning - Sup port Vector Machines is the subject of a report. According to news reporting out of Tabasco, Mexico, by NewsRx editors, research stated, “We consider multicateg ory extensions of binary discrimination methods via one-versus-one (OVO) or one- versus-rest (OVR) methodologies, focusing on extensions of the binary classifica tion by linear mean difference (MD), support vector machine (SVM), maximal data piling (MDP), and distance weighted discrimination (DWD) via OVO, and the multic ategory extension of MD via OVR, in the context of high-dimensional and low samp le size (HDLSS) data. The asymptotic behavior of OVO-MD, OVO-SVM, OVO-MDP and OV ODWD is described when the dimension of the data increases and the sample size is fixed, in terms of the probabilities of correct classification of a new data point, finding sufficient conditions for the correct classification probabilitie s to converge to one as the dimension approaches infinity.”
